- MSS Mus. 1034-1039. ‘Dolores’ Manuscripts: manuscripts of music composed by Ellen Elizabeth Dickson (b.1819, d.1878), also known as Dolores, and others; 19th cent. All works by ‘Dolores’ are autograph in ink except where otherwise indicated. Works by other composers are copies. The names of composers, dedicatees and authors of words are listed in the index to this catalogue. Presented by Burnaby M. Portal, 13 May 2003. Six volumes. British Library arrangement.

- MS Mus. 1122. Iphigénie en Aulide: Arrangement by Richard Wagner (WWV 77) of Christoph Willibald Gluck’s opera; circa 1850. Ink copy of full score. German. Wagner’s arrangement was first performed in Dresden at the Königlich Sächsisches Hoftheater, Dresden on 24 Feb. 1847, with Wagner conducting. No autograph of the arrangement appears to exist, though a printed full score and vocal score of the original, held in the Nationalarchiv der Richard-Wagner-Stiftung, Bayreuth, both have autogr...
